Strategies for Tackling iSocial SA1 Questions
So, you've got the iSocial 2023 SA1 question paper, you know the topics – now what? How do you actually tackle these questions to get the best possible score? Let's talk strategy, guys. First off, read the instructions carefully. This sounds obvious, but seriously, so many marks are lost because students didn't follow simple instructions like 'answer all questions' or 'choose any three'. Always, always, always read the rubric and specific instructions for each section and question. Next, time management is your best friend. Before you even start writing, take a minute to quickly scan the entire paper. Allocate a rough amount of time for each section based on the marks allocated. If a question is worth 15 marks, it deserves significantly more time and a more detailed answer than a 2-mark question. Don't get bogged down on one difficult question early on; make a note and come back to it if time permits. For objective questions, be decisive. If you're unsure, make an educated guess, but don't spend ages agonizing over it. Move on! When it comes to short answer questions, get straight to the point. Use clear and concise language. Avoid rambling. Think about what the question is really asking and answer that directly. Use keywords from the question in your answer where appropriate – it shows you understand what's being asked. For the essay or long answer questions, this is where you need to deploy your critical thinking skills. Outline your answer before you start writing. A quick mind map or a few bullet points can save you a lot of time and ensure your answer is logical, well-structured, and covers all the necessary points. Start with a clear introductory statement that directly addresses the question. Develop your points in separate paragraphs, each focusing on a specific idea or piece of evidence. Use examples from your studies – the iSocial 2023 SA1 paper is designed to see if you can apply your knowledge. Conclude with a summary statement that reinforces your main argument. Remember to cite your sources if required, although for most SA1 papers, this is less common unless specifically stated. Practice using the iSocial 2023 SA1 question paper as a revision tool. Try answering it under timed conditions. This builds exam stamina and helps you refine your strategy. Identify questions you found challenging and revisit the relevant material. Did you struggle with a specific type of question? Focus your revision there. Don't just passively review; actively do. This hands-on approach is what separates good students from great ones.
